The salary statistics and trend of bill and account collectors in the industry of building finishing contractors are shown in the following tables and chart. In Table 3 we compare bill and account collector salaries in different industries within the construction sector.
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$30,630 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$34,150 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$37,760 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$42,430 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$55,270 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for bill and account collectors in the industry of building finishing contractors.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) bill and account collectors is $55,270.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$37,760.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ent bill and account collectors is $30,630.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of bill and account collectors in the industry of Building Finishing Contractors from 2012 to 2017.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2017 | $37,760 | 4.00% | 2.38% |
| 2016 | $36,250 | 6.23% | - |
| 2015 | $33,990 | -0.79% | - |
| 2014 | $34,260 | -11.12% | - |
| 2013 | $38,070 | 3.18% | - |
| 2012 | $36,860 | - | - |
